What does the letter "N" stand for in hair color? The letter "N" in hair color stands for "Neutral." It is used to describe a natural, balanced shade that does not lean too warm or too cool. This makes it a popular choice for those seeking a versatile and natural-looking hair color.
What Does "N" Mean in Hair Color?
The "N" in hair color, representing Neutral, is a staple in hair dye terminology. Neutral shades are designed to mimic natural hair tones, offering a balanced hue that lacks the undertones found in other color categories. These shades are ideal for covering gray hair or achieving a subtle, natural look.

How Do Neutral Shades Compare to Other Hair Colors?
Neutral shades differ from warm and cool tones, which have distinct undertones. Here’s a comparison:
| Feature | Neutral Shades (N) | Warm Shades (W) | Cool Shades (C)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Undertone | Balanced | Red/Gold | Blue/Green |
| Best For | All skin tones | Warm skin tones | Cool skin tones |
| Gray Coverage | Excellent | Good | Good |
How to Choose the Right Neutral Shade?
Selecting the right neutral hair color involves considering your natural hair color, skin tone, and personal style. Here are some tips:
- Match Your Base: Choose a shade close to your natural hair color for a subtle change.
- Consider Skin Tone: Neutral shades work well with both warm and cool skin tones.
- Try a Sample: Use a temporary dye to test how a neutral shade looks on you.

How Often Should You Touch Up Neutral Hair Color?
Touch-up frequency depends on hair growth and personal preference. Generally, every 4-6 weeks is recommended to maintain a consistent color and cover any new gray hairs.
